Comprehensive update workflow

Below is a practical, end-to-end workflow that can be followed for any combination of updates:

  1. Sign into your eCitizen account on a private device with a secure connection.
  2. Navigate to Profile Settings or Account Management and choose the specific field to update (email, phone, password, or other personal information).
  3. Enter the new value and submit the change to trigger OTP or security verification.
  4. Enter the verification code sent to your new contact method or registered device to authorize the update.
  5. Confirm the update, save changes, and log out if the session remains active.
  6. Check for a confirmation notification in-app or via email/SMS and verify that the new data is reflected in your profile.

[Question]How do I change my email address on eCitizen?

To update the email on your eCitizen account, sign in to the portal, navigate to Account Management or Profile Settings, and select the email field to replace it with your new address. You will typically receive a verification OTP to the new email or the registered phone to confirm the change. Once verified, save the updates and look for a confirmation notice.

[Question]Can I change my phone number in eCitizen?

Yes. Start by logging into your eCitizen account, go to Profile Settings or Contact Information, and choose to edit your phone number. After entering the new number, you will receive an OTP for verification. Enter the OTP to complete the change, then save the updated profile and wait for the confirmation message. This is common practice across government portals to ensure you retain control of contact channels.

[Question]How do I change my password on eCitizen?

First, sign in and locate the Security or Password section in your account settings. Enter your current password, then set a new, strong password that combines upper and lower case letters, numbers, and symbols. After saving, you may be prompted for a re-login to apply the new credentials. This step is critical to prevent unauthorized access, especially if you've updated your contact details.

[Question]What if I can't log in to eCitizen to make changes?

If you can't access your account, start with the password recovery or account recovery option on the login page. You may be asked to provide identifying information, a National ID number, and recent contact details to verify your identity. If recovery emails or OTPs aren't arriving, you should contact official support channels for guided assistance and consider submitting identity verification docs as requested.
